With a new American president taking office, the United States are not the only ones saying goodbye to dignitaries; the Danish people are saying goodbye to the United States Ambassador to Denmark, Rufus Gifford.
He was the Finance Director of Barack Obamaβs 2012 presidential campaign, and after the election, President Obama nominated him for Ambassador to Denmark.
Rufus Gifford is openly gay and married his long-term partner, Stephen DeVincent, at Copenhagen City Hall in 2015.
Today he received one of the highest orders Denmark can offer; he was knighted by Queen Margrethe II, receiving the Order of the Dannebrog, with diamonds in the cross as a special honor. (Similar to receiving the Presidential Medal of Freedom with distinction.)
Gifford and his partner are loved by the Danish people; in public people cheer him, beg him to stay in the country, and encourage him to run for president in the US, if he insists on leaving us.
